Harold W. Smith Obituary

With heavy hearts, we announce the death of Harold W. Smith (Columbus, Texas), born in West Frankfort, Illinois, who passed away on January 9, 2020 at the age of 89. Family and friends are welcome to leave their condolences on this memorial page and share them with the family.

He was predeceased by : his parents, Earl G. Smith and Ruth Williams Smith; his son Mike Smith; and his stepgrandson Kirby Adams. He is survived by : his wife Ann; his children, Debbie Perkins (Ralph) and Dan Smith (Lisa); his sister Joyce Flannery; his stepsons, DeGraaf Adams and Will Adams; his grandsons, Scott Perkins, Michael Smith and Samuel Smith; and his nephews, Christopher Smith, Randy Smith and Bryan Smith. He is also survived by eight grandchildren and eight great-grandchildren.

In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the First Baptist Church, P.O. Box 367, Columbus, Texas 78934.
